WA Department of Disabilities- Person Centered Planning (2021- present)
Working with Washington DDA, Gwen’s Guidance is offering Person centered Planning.
Person-Centered Planning is a collaborative, strengths-based approach that focuses on an individual’s goals, preferences, values, and vision for their life despite and societal or physical barriers. Rather than fitting a person into predetermined systems or expectations, the process centers their voice, choices, and unique support needs. As a facilitator, Gwen also honors and brings together any communal, systemic, or personal supports the individual may want to be apart of the process. PCP helps create meaningful, individualized plans that promote autonomy, inclusion, self-determination, and overall quality of life with tangible steps for all parties involved.
